The'yre just Spi coopers with a modified cylinder head, high lift roller rockers, janspeed exhaust, induction kit and probably a different ECU map (not sure about this). I dont think they were fitted with different throttle body, and surely they arent hans teeth believe me.
Apart for that they're just 'normal' minis and everything you need is available at most mini parts suppliers cheaper than any other modern car parts.
